# Break-Glass: Profile Store Resharding

For the eng sync: if a reshard of the Quillbase user-profile store stalls mid-migration, break-glass access lets you halt shard rebalancing directly. Two approvers required; actions are logged. To unlock the emergency console, enter the passphrase shown immediately below this paragraph.

recovery phrase for yahag-yagap: pramir-normir-norius-kasax

Q: How do I get into the shared lab on level 3?

The Calder Lab is shared between our Instruments group and the neighbouring Signal Bench team at Orrin Park Campus. Your standard badge covers the corridor, but the lab door itself is on a separate reader. Book bench time in the shared calendar first, and always log equipment use in the ledger by the door. Once your booking is confirmed, you can enter using the shared lab code shown below.

badge for fafop-fajof: bdg-Z-47

Handing off the Quillbus broker upgrade (4.x to 5.1) to Dario. Cluster is half-migrated; mixed-version mode is supported but TLS cert rotation must finish before cutover. No auth model changes, though the admin API gained two new endpoints worth reviewing. Open questions and the migration checklist are tracked on the internal page below.

dashboard of taduf-bawef = https://jira.lumicsys.internal/projects/display/browse/b1cbf89d

Subject: Gridsmith cut-over complete — summary

Hi,

The cut-over of the Gridsmith crossword generator to the new clue-ranking backend finished last night without rollback. Puzzle generation latency dropped roughly a third, and the dictionary sync job now runs hourly instead of daily. Two minor issues surfaced (stale theme cache, one stuck worker) and both were resolved before morning. For your records, the production service now runs with the following configuration.

settings of fafog-haduf:
ZORIX_PIN=4648
ZORIX_METRICS_HOST=metrics.zorix.paliqsys.corp
ZORIX_LOG_LEVEL=info
ZORIX_TENANT=druix